Russia claims to have struck Ukrainian energy grids, drone hubs, and mercenary barracks.

The press office of the Russian Ministry of Defense stated that targets within Ukraine's transport and energy grids, along with army logistics hubs, were subjected to attacks over a twenty-four-hour period. Strikes came from drone detachments, artillery units, rocket forces, and tactical aviation groups operating under the Armed Forces of Russia. The official statement declared that damage was inflicted upon facilities belonging to the Ukrainian military infrastructure and supply chains used for their benefit. Russian troops reportedly targeted workshops assembling unmanned aerial vehicles and locations where these machines were stored. Warehouses hit during these attacks held spare parts for drones, according to the report. Units of the Russian Armed Forces also struck temporary billets housing Ukrainian soldiers and foreign mercenaries across 158 districts. The news feed remains updated as new data arrives.
